What are the in-demand Information Technology Jobs in 2021?

If you’re looking for a career where you can learn, grow and help companies get creative solutions to complicated troubles, then take a look at a profession in it.

Computer and information technologies are just one of today’s quickest growing career areas. There is likely to be than 550,000 new work in this particular industry through 2026, based on the Department of Labor. Experts foresee a lot of the future development in It will probably be motivated by a greater emphasis on a cloud computer, big data and cybersecurity.

If you’re seeking a career where you can learn, develop and support organizations find creative solutions to complex difficulties, a career in IT can be quite a good fit for you. This article is among the fastest-growing work available:

1. Software Developer

Software developers would be the creative minds behind your computer and smartphone technologies we use for function, school, leisure and everything in between. Firms depend upon software developers to produce new technology-driven alternatives and execute enhancements and maintenance on the current software program.

2. Computer Support Specialists

Technologies provide the groundwork for up to all business activities, so it’s necessary to have computer support specialists on personnel who is able to troubleshoot system and customer problems. The studies experts reported faster than average employment growth for computer support specialist professionals. Over 88,000 jobs are going to be created between 2016 and 2026.

You can begin your career as a computer support specialist by earning a Diploma in Information Technology. An associate degree can prepare you for several entry-level jobs in this industry, even though a bachelor’s education may be needed for some positions.

3. Computer System Administrators

Computer system administrators aid handle the day-to-day operations and security of your company’s computer system. This could consist of installing new hardware and software and producing recommendations for upgrades to a company’s present systems. Work for system administrators is anticipated to develop by 6 percentage through 2026, introducing 24,000 new jobs.

Most companies require system administrators to get a bachelor’s degree in information technology or perhaps an associated concentration.

4. Cloud Systems Engineer

As increasing numbers of businesses purchase cloud technology, technical engineers’ need for cloud solutions is predicted to grow swiftly. According to a newly released report on modern technology hiring tendencies, most cloud systems technical engineers use a bachelor’s degree in technology and five or even more several years of experience as a system engineer. These pros are highly specialized and will get results for main technology organizations, such as Amazon Web Services, OpenStack, or Microsoft.

5. Database Developer

Collecting and analyzing information may help companies make strategic business decisions. Database developers create solutions and deal with the web servers that allow firms to kind and retailer their data securely.

Earning your bachelor’s education in data analytics is a fantastic way to place yourself in an entry-level position as a database manager. The job of database administrators is projected to grow by 11% from 2016 to 2026, introducing greater than 13,000 new jobs.

6. Security Analyst

Cybersecurity is a major point of problem for several businesses, especially those that cope with significant personal details, including healthcare companies, financial institutions and economic services organizations and government departments. A details breach could have long-lasting, pricey effects on an organization’s reputation.

As an info security analyst, it is possible to help businesses safeguard themselves from cybersecurity dangers.

A bachelor’s degree in cybersecurity will help prepare you for entry-level jobs within this industry, such as a computer security specialist or security professional.

7. IT Manager

Business needs skilled IT executives to suggest and guideline them since they broaden their digital functionality. IT managers aid firms examine their technologies demands and manage the changeover to new tools and systems.
